一年前的坠机事件仍在困扰着孟加拉国达卡的受害者和幸存者。2025年7月21日,一架孟加拉国空军训练机在达卡市里程碑学校坠毁,造成36人死亡,其中大多数是儿童,160余人受伤 [1]。
调查委员会已于去年11月向政府提交报告,但内容至今未向公众公开 [1]。根据现有信息,调查发现多项问题:学校建筑不符合规范、飞行员训练不足且监督不当,而飞机本身并无技术故障 [1]。更为广泛的安全隐患是,达卡国际机场附近有600多栋建筑(包括学校和医院)违反了高度限制规定 [1]。
在纪念活动中,受害者家属表达了对未来的担忧。死亡者丈夫曼苏尔·海拉尔指出:"没有人能保证另一架飞机不会再次坠落到这所学校" [1]。学校存在的安全隐患令人瞩目——该校仅有一扇门,却容纳800至900名学生 [1]。
政府方面,卫生部长萨达尔·萨哈瓦特·侯赛因表示将为需要进一步医疗治疗的幸存者提供支持 [1]。但受害者家属和幸存者的主要诉求是获得完整的调查报告、政府赔偿以及心理健康帮助——一年后,学生们仍然受到创伤的困扰 [1]。
A Bangladesh Air Force training aircraft crashed at Milestone School in Dhaka on July 21, 2025, killing 36 people, the majority of them children, with over 160 others injured [1]. One year after the disaster, victims' families and survivors are pressing the government to release the investigation findings and provide financial compensation, while students continue to grapple with psychological trauma from the incident [1].
An investigative committee submitted its report to the government in November of the following year, but the findings have not been made public [1]. The investigation identified multiple contributing factors: the school failed to meet building code standards, the pilot had inadequate training, and there was insufficient pilot oversight, though no technical fault with the aircraft was found [1].
Safety concerns extend beyond the school itself. More than 600 buildings near Dhaka International Airport, including schools and hospitals, violate height restrictions in place to prevent such incidents [1].
Survivor Mansur Helal, a husband of one of the victims, addressed the memorial gathering with stark concern: "No one can guarantee that another plane will not crash into this school again" [1]. Health Minister Sadar Sahawat Hossein stated the government would provide continued medical support to survivors requiring further treatment [1].
The school's inadequate infrastructure has also come to light—despite housing 800 to 900 students, the facility has only one exit [1].
